Pokedex Entries

GameEntry
UltraSunIt travels by digging through the ground. Diglett and Dunsparce share one another’s tunnels happily.
UltraMoonWhen it sees a person, it digs a hole with its tail to make its escape. If you happen to find one, consider yourself lucky.
